More Crew, Less Stress for You!

You’ve made it to the day and already have enough on your head. Once you are ready to party, you can let go knowing you can rely on a trusty crew to keep things moving and grooving. Whether it’s managing the flow of activities, running games, distributing prizes, or making sure the guest of honor gets lifted in the chair, they ensure everyone knows what to do at all times. Just follow their lead! Generally, two dance motivators will round out your crew nicely (alongside a DJ & MC).

But Aren’t They Intimidating?

They might look great and have all the cool moves, but the role of a dancer is not to intimidate, it’s to motivate! Whether your child is outgoing or shy, a good dance motivator will know how to make him or her feel confident and celebrated. They’re also skilled at reading the room. They know how to adapt and interact with guests of all ages, whether it’s a young child or a grandparent. Party motivators are approachable and have great energy–after all, they’re there to bring the fun!
